Chapter Four: Quidditch.
---Draco's POV---
Draco woke late on Saturday morning. Today he would be playing Quidditch, and he certainly wasn't looking forward to it. As much as Draco loved the game, he loathed playing against the Gryffindors. He hadn't ever one a match against them, and was hardly positive of ever doing so.
Hermione was reading her magazine 'Witchy' again, and hadn't even noticed Draco's presence.
'What's that magazine about?' Draco asked as he slicked his hair back.
Hermione jumped, and then sighed as she realized it was Draco. 'Draco! You gave me an awful fright! The magazine is a girly one. You wouldn't want to read it, trust me. It just has spells and things for girls. Nothing important. They're quite complicated, but some have the most wonderful effects. Like that braiding one I used yesterday. Braiding without using magic takes forever, so it really is a great spell!'
Draco nodded quickly. 'You coming to watch the match today?'
'Yeah, I'll probably go and watch it. Harry and Ron are awfully excited. First match of the year and all.'
'Yeah. Should be interesting.'
Hermione raised her eyebrows and nodded. She started enchanting her hair to go into all different styles. She finally decided on cute little ringlets.
Meanwhile Draco had brought his brand new broomstick down to polish it with his 'Broom Servicing Kit.' Hermione noticed it was a lot like Harry's although much more elegant and it had an expensive touch to it.
After breakfast, and a brief encounter with Pansy Parkinson, Draco made his way down to the Quidditch Pitch to prepare for his dreaded match. Draco couldn't stand being humiliated when Scar Head triumphantly snatched the snitch away. He couldn't face Hermione, Harry or even his fellow Slytherins for days after his defeat. Draco hated losing, and was a very competitive person.
After an annoying pep talk from the Quidditch Captain, Draco got changed and pulled out his broom. He fixed his hair, and then joined his teammates, ready to play Quidditch.
He stepped out onto the Quidditch pitch, the stadium roaring. The atmosphere was breath taking.
'Mount your brooms.' Madame Hooch called, and several seconds later, blew her whistle for the game to begin.
The Gryffindors snatched away the quaffle, and the Gryffindors roared. Draco instantly snapped his focus away from Ginny Weasley, who was gracefully soaring through the air in chase of the Quaffle. She'd given him a nasty little grin, and soared away. Draco knew he was in for it after that.
Draco instantly went searching for a flicker of gold. Playing Seeker was an extremely difficult job. Your concentration had to be fixed on looking for the snitch, watching for Bludgers and looking out for the opposing seeker who could have spotted the Snitch at any second.
Draco was surprised to see that the Gryffindor Quidditch Captain had swapped the positions generously. Whoever it was had finally given Ron a break from being the Keeper, and had instead assigned him to playing Beater alongside his sister, Ginny. The Chasers were Colin Creevy, Dean Thomas and Seamus Finnigan. Draco was debating if Colin was a good choice. He was an energetic little kid, but he often let his mind wander off. The keeper was handed to Jessica Ray, who was only in her second year but had an astounding amount of talent.
'10 Points to Gryffindor,' Lavendar Brown squealed as Dean Thomas threw the Quaffle through Kevin Burrows outstretched hands.
The game went on until the score was Gryffindor-70 points Slytherin-50 points. The crowd was much less energetic, as the game had been going on for quite a long time.
Ron Weasley flew towards a particularly slow Bludger and hit it as hard as humanly possible towards Draco Malfoy. Unfortunately at that very second Draco and Harry had spotted the snitch and had instantly sped towards it. Draco's fingers were almost touching the snitch just as the Bludger hit him on his right arm. He fell off his broom and fell to the ground, almost screaming in pain.
Seconds before Draco passed out, the crowd gasped. Before Draco knew it they roared excitedly. Gryffindor had defeated Slytherin.
That night Draco awoke in the Hospital Wing. His arm was extremely sore. For anyone other then Draco, the pain would have been close to unbearable. Being a Malfoy Draco had learnt to hide his pain at all costs. Today was no exception.
Madame Pomfrey bustled towards him. 'Malfoy, drink this.' She shoved a goblet of blood red potion into his face. It smelled like chocolates, so Draco eagerly downed the potion. Instead of the charming flavor of chocolate he was overtaken by a terrible taste. Draco couldn't quite place it, but 'Completely Revolting' just about summed it up.
'Mr Malfoy, your wrist and arm have been broken and you have suffered a slight concussion. Both of your ankles have been sprained. You've suffered quite an ordeal. I've mended your wrist and arm, although you will find they will be a bit sore for a while. As for your ankles, they're completely fine now I've fixed them, even so you might find a little bit of difficulty walking,' Madame Pomfrey explained. Draco nodded and tried to relax. His wrists were killing him.
Several days later Madame Pomfrey told him he was right to leave. He awkwardly rose and stalked up to the common room. Luckily it was after dark, so Draco could roam the castle in peace. Before he knew it Draco found himself at the portrait hole. He clambered through it to find Hermione lying on the couch, her hair twisted into an awfully messy bun.
She suddenly noticed him and jumped out of her seat. His hair had fallen loose in his face, making him look very cute. He gave her a slight smile.
'Draco! You're finally back! I've been so worried about you!' Hermione said, checking Draco for signs of injuries.
'I'm fine Hermione, really, Madame Pomfrey fixed me up.' Draco said and gave Hermione a reassuring grin.
'Thank goodness. I've been so worried Draco! Promise me you'll never EVER scare me like this again!'
'I swear I'll never intentionally scare you.'
Hermione smiled and gave Draco a quick hug. 'You need rest!' With that Hermione took Draco into his room. It was exactly the same as Hermione's although it had been decorated in Silver and Green instead of Red and Gold.
'Thanks Hermione.' Draco clambered into the bed and closed his eyes. He really had gotten a lot of sleep, although he found himself once again truly exhausted.
'Good night Draco,' Hermione whispered.
'Night Hermione.' Draco whispered in reply.
'Sweet dreams, Goodnight, Don't let the bedbugs bite,' Hermione whispered, and left a smirking Draco alone to sleep.
---Hermione's POV---
The next morning Hermione slid down the rail of the staircase. She was in a fantastic mood. It was her favourite day, Saturday. As much as Hermione hated to admit, she rather liked it when she had no lessons to attend. She could just relax in the library, common room or even outside with all of her friends. Draco was already awake.
'You're supposed to be resting!' she sighed.
'Good Morning to you too, Hermione, and if you must know I couldn't sleep,' Draco informed her.
Hermione smiled at him and sat down next to him. She obviously hadn't bothered with her hair. It was once again terribly bushy.
Draco put an arm around her and they sat in silence for quite some time. 'YOU'RE eating breakfast now,' Hermione demanded as she skipped up to Dobby who had just arrived to do the daily cleaning. 'Dobby, some cereal please.'
Minutes later Dobby returned with two bowels of cereal.
'Mistress Hermione, Dobby put in extra milk, just how mistress likes them!' Dobby cried with a toothy grin.
'Thanks Dobby,' Hermione smiled in return, and turned towards Draco. 'Eat,' she said.
Draco smiled and immediately got stuck into his breakfast, not wanting to disappoint Hermione.
When he had finally finished he looked up at Hermione expectantly. 'Finished.'
'Good boy Draco, you've done well for yourself.' Hermione smiled evilly at him. 'Now drink this water.'
'Hermione!' Draco whined.
'It makes you recover quicker!'
Draco sighed and downed the water. 'Ok, I hope you're done with me now because I'm not completing anymore of you tasks.'
'Oh, I'm finished Draco.' Hermione had already started on her hair by this time. She wet it, and gave it a fresh smell of Apples. She then straitened it as it began to rebush itself. After trying what seemed like thousands of different styles, Hermione decided on a straight look, the one she had first tried.
'All that for nothing, eh Hermione,' Draco laughed.
'Oh, no. It's great practice, and this way I'm free to fiddle with it all day long!'
Draco raised an eyebrow and just smirked.
After quite some time, Hermione settled on the couch and started reading. Lately she hadn't been doing much, and today she must have been catching up.
Her face changed from deep concentration to an expression of boredom. She finally decided to put the book down, and glanced around the room, apparently searching for something to do. With a triumphant smile, Hermione skipped back up the stairs.
When she returned she was carrying a large case with different sections.
'What on earth is that for Hermione?' Draco asked beginning to laugh.
Hermione smiled. 'These? I'm going to make myself a bracelet, the muggle way. Using magic all the time does get a little boring.'
Draco nodded, and watched her as she threaded various beads onto the string. She had an interesting pattern of three greens and two golds. In the middle she used lettered beads to spell 'Hermione.'
She looked up at Draco who had been watching her the whole time. 'Why are you looking at me, Draco?'
'I'm not looking at you out of choice, I'm watching you make your little bracelet there, if you hadn't noticed I'm a bit bored.'
Hermione nodded and tied the bracelet around her left wrist. She beamed at her creation, and then took her bead set back up the stairs. When she returned she announced that there would be a Prefects meeting today at 1:30. She demanded Draco be dressed by the time it started, and went to organize herself.
Since it was a Saturday, Hermione dressed herself in muggle clothes. Most people dressed in robes all the time, but Hermione found them quite uncomfortable. Today she slid down the rail wearing jeans with a butterfly on the back pocket. She was wearing a plain white top that fitted her perfectly. The white top showed her stomach off wonderfully, and the red scarf that was wrapped around her neck made her picture perfect.
She reached the table where she had left her makeup, and once again applied lipgloss, mascara and today a light blue eye shadow. Hermione put her fingers through her knotless hair to take away the dead straight look. She looked great.
Just as she threw the makeup aside, Ginny Weasley fell through the portrait hole.
Draco shook his head and tried to hide a laugh as Ginny stood up. Her red hair was in curls. She was wearing a knee length denim skirt with a yellow boob tube.
'Hey, Gin,' Hermione smiled.
'Hello Hermione! You look heaps pretty, I love the top!' Ginny answered.
'Thanks, you don't look too bad yourself, I love the skirt, I've been looking for one of those although I want one with pleats. They're really pretty!'
Malfoy rolled his eyes as the girls went on with their girl talk. Malfoy was thankful when Justin Flinch Flethchly strutted through the door.
He was wearing Hogwarts robes, like most boys. Malfoy stood to greet him, but the pain in his ankle made him flinch. Hermione gave him a sheepish look, so he instantly sat back down.
After everyone arrived, Hermione sat down at the long table next to Malfoy, who everyone had helped up.
'I expect you all know what you're here for then!' Hermione began.
